Re: rmi problems with latest visad.jar

  • To: Doug Lindholm <lind@xxxxxxxx>
  • Subject: Re: rmi problems with latest visad.jar
  • From: Tom Rink <rink@xxxxxxxxxxxxx>
  • Date: Thu, 14 Aug 2003 13:37:23 -0500
Hi Doug,

Are the client and server both using the same version of visad.jar?


Doug Lindholm wrote:


When I switched to the latest visad.jar file I started getting exceptions like below. It works fine with an older version of visad.jar. I have been careful to make sure the rmiregistry, server, and client are all running with the same classpath. I have a RemoteServerImpl (with RemoteDataReferenceImpls) bound to my server but when I try to access the data from my client:

java.rmi.UnmarshalException: error unmarshalling return; nested exception is: writing aborted; java.lang.Object
        at sun.rmi.server.UnicastRef.invoke(
        at visad.RemoteFieldImpl_Stub.local(Unknown Source)
at edu.ucar.rap.vmet.VMETDisplayer.getSourceData( at edu.ucar.rap.vmet.GriddedDisplayer.processData( at edu.ucar.rap.vmet.VMETDisplayer.updateData( at edu.ucar.rap.vmet.VMETDisplayer$UpdateCell.doAction(
        at visad.util.ThreadPool$
Caused by: writing aborted; java.lang.Object at at at at at at at at at at at at
        at sun.rmi.server.UnicastRef.unmarshalValue(
        at sun.rmi.server.UnicastRef.invoke(
        ... 7 more
Caused by: java.lang.Object
at at at at at at at at at at at at
        at sun.rmi.server.UnicastRef.marshalValue(
at sun.rmi.server.UnicastServerRef.dispatch(
        at sun.rmi.transport.Transport$
        at Method)
        at sun.rmi.transport.Transport.serviceCall(
at sun.rmi.transport.tcp.TCPTransport.handleMessages( at sun.rmi.transport.tcp.TCPTransport$

Any ideas?


